Delta Gamma on Happy Days?
i was watching a Happy Days rerun and Delta Gamma was prominent in it.
The boys were dating Delta Gammas and there was going to be a pinning ceremony.
And the Delta Gammas sang some song that mentioned anchors in it.
Anyone else see this? And would they have needed DG's permission?

I think this has been discussed, but one of the producers of Happy Days was a Beta Theta Pi (you'll see their paddle in Arnold's), and someone else in production (one of the writers?) was a Delta Gamma. Pretty cool, huh?

I think the difference with Happy Days is they had an actual DG on staff and they were portraying Greek life in a positive way. When they were pledging a mean fraternity (that they depledged) the letters were fake - I think it was Pi or Phi Kappa Nu.

Not to mention that the book version of Legally Blonde uses real sororities names. Elle is a Delta Gamma, the woman she defends is a Kappa Alpha Theta, and Chutney, the real murderer, is a Kappa. So it doesn't even seem to me that the publishers restricted themselves to using names only with positive portrayals!
